FreeBASIC
Development
FreeBASIC is an open-source, free BASIC compiler for Windows, Linux, and macOS. It is compatible with QBasic/QuickBASIC and allows developers to easily create console, graphical GUI, and web applications. FreeBASIC supports modern features like object-oriented programming.

Notation Player 3
Audio & Music
Notation Player 3 is a music notation software designed for viewing, playing back, and printing sheet music. It supports a wide variety of file formats and has an intuitive interface for managing music scores.
